Sunday, March 1, 2009

Lawmen 32 Outlaws 2

Last night the NorCal Lawmen football team faced off against the East Bay Outlaws. Hundreds of local fans filled the stadium at Pittsburg H.S. on both sides of the field. The concession stand was sold out by halftime there was so many people.

Don't let the score fool you. This was a fast paced attack by the Lawmen which took place mostly in the first half with lots of exciting plays. The second half found the Lawmen fine tuning each position bringing in their second and third string players to get them some on field experience prior to the league starting in two weeks back here at Pittsburg H.S.

One also needed to make note that there was no less than 5 other league teams there scouting the Lawmen.

Thank you Lawmen and Outlaws for a great game. And thank you especially to the Lawmen for their donations to the Oakland Children's Hospital.

49ers and the Raiders

The Bay Area is one of the luckiest in the Nation when it comes to sports teams. We have the 49ers, Raiders, Giants, A's, Kings, Sharks, and quite a few semi pro teams to choose from. The 49ers and the Raiders have brought alot of bragging rights in our area when it comes to football in the 80's and 90's. But what happened? Eddie De bartolo departed in 2000 and left control to his sister and the 49ers have been on a steady losing streak ever since. The Raiders even with there big ticket contract deals and aquisitions can't seem to put together a season either. What's it going to take to get these 2 teams back to playoff contention?
